A few interesting observations about bass feeding habits / lure selection
ITs not just big bait= big fish, it also relies on the profile of the bait. a big bass might take down a 10 inch shiner, but it would try to take down a 10 bluegill. i watched something on this on north american fisherman and it made alot of sense. Bass(and other predators) know what will swallow easy and what wont. a long slender fish will go down much easier that a tall pan fish. Also as someone noted earlier big bas are big because they understand they cannot exert more energy than they will get from the food they eat. If a healthy 8inch shiner goes swimming by a no prepared bass it my pass knowing it would take to much energy but if a wounded 6inch goes by, you bet he's gonna go get his free meal.
